Markdown TOC Generator
Generate table of contents links from markdown headings
Input Markdown
Generated TOC
Markdown TOC ジェネレーターとは?
ナビゲートしにくくなってきた ドキュメント や長いREADMEを作っていますか?目次(TOC)があれば、読者が気になるセクションにすぐジャンプできます。このツールは Markdown ファイルをスキャンして全見出し(H1〜H6)を見つけ、適切なアンカーリンクを生成し、文書の先頭に貼り付けられる構造化されたTOCを作成します。
ジェネレーターはGitHub互換のアンカー形式を使用しているため、TOCはGitHub・GitLab・その他のMarkdownをレンダリングするプラットフォームで完璧に機能します。見出しレベルをインテリジェントに処理し、TOCの深さを制御(H2〜H3のみ表示、またはH6まで全レベルを含める)でき、適切なインデントとネストを自動生成するため構造が一目瞭然です。
TOCは常に見出しと同期しており、壊れたアンカーリンクや古いセクション参照の問題が起きません。見出し内の特殊文字も正しく処理され、出力はすぐに貼り付けられる状態です。すべてがブラウザ内で即座に処理され、サーバーへのアップロードは一切不要です。
Markdown TOC ジェネレーターの使い方
Markdownの見出しから目次を生成する手順を説明します。このページの実際のコントロールを使います。
貼り付け・アップロード・サンプル読み込み
左の Markdown 入力 パネルにMarkdownを貼り付けるか、アップロード をクリックして .md ファイルを読み込みます。サンプル をクリックするとサンプルAPIドキュメントが表示されます。ツールは見出し(# 〜 ######)をスキャンします。
最小・最大レベルを設定
最小 H と 最大 H のドロップダウンで、TOCに表示する見出しレベルを制御します。出力は即座に更新されます。GitHub互換のアンカーリンクが生成されます。
コピーまたはダウンロード
コピー または ダウンロード をクリックして出力を使用します。文書の先頭に貼り付けてください。クリア で最初からやり直せます。すべての処理はブラウザで行われます。
実際の活用シーン
GitHub README ファイル
プロジェクト用の充実したREADMEを作っていますか?TOCがあれば、セットアップ・設定・APIドキュメント・コントリビューションのセクションにすぐアクセスできます。GitHubは動作するアンカーリンク付きでTOCを自動レンダリングし、完璧なナビゲーションを実現します。
ドキュメントサイト
20ページ以上の大規模なドキュメントプロジェクトには構造が必要です。各ページのTOCを生成し、サイト全体のマスターTOCを作成します。明確な構造によって読者がドキュメントを自信を持って読み進められます。
Wikiページ
長い記事を含む社内Wikiやナレッジベースを作っていますか?各ページの先頭にTOCがあると使いやすさが向上します。GitHub Wiki・GitLab Wiki・その他のMarkdownベースのWikiで動作します。
長文コンテンツ
ブログ記事・チュートリアル・ガイド、その他あらゆる長いMarkdownドキュメントはTOCがあると便利です。速読する読者が関連セクションにジャンプできます。複数のステップとセクションがある技術チュートリアルに特に役立ちます。
よくある質問
アンカーリンクを手動で作成する必要がありますか?
いいえ。ツールが自動的に生成します。GitHub・GitLab・ほとんどの CommonMark 準拠プラットフォームは見出しからアンカーを自動生成するため、生成されたTOCリンクは追加作業なしにすぐ機能します。
アンカー形式はすべてのプラットフォームで機能しますか?
ジェネレーターは最も広くサポートされているGitHub互換のアンカー形式を使用しています。GitHub・GitLab・その他ほとんどのMarkdownプラットフォームがこの形式をネイティブサポートしています。具体的なアンカーの動作はご使用のプラットフォームのドキュメントをご確認ください。
見出し内の特殊文字はどのように処理されますか?
ジェネレーターは特殊文字を自動的にアンカー対応の形式に変換します。スペースはハイフンに、大文字は小文字に変換され、特殊な句読点は変換または削除されます。生成されるアンカーは常に有効で正しく機能します。
TOCの深さを調整できますか?
もちろんです。「最小 H」ドロップダウンで最小見出しレベル(H1、H2 など)を、「最大 H」で最大を制御します。H2〜H3だけにしたい場合は最小をH2・最大をH3に設定します。完全なTOCが必要な場合はH1〜H6の全レベルを含めます。
見出しに数字や記号が含まれている場合はどうなりますか?
正しく処理されます。「ステップ1:はじめに」のような見出しは #ステップ1はじめに のようなアンカーに変換されます。特殊文字は標準的なMarkdownアンカールールに従って処理されるため、リンクは常に機能します。
Markdownのコンテンツは保存されますか?
いいえ。すべてのTOC生成はJavaScriptを使ってブラウザ内で行われます。あなたのMarkdownはコンピューターの外に出ることなく、データの保存や分析も行いません。完全なプライバシーとセキュリティを保ちます。